我们通常所说的DML、DDL、DCL语句都是sql*plus语句,它们执行完后,都可以保存在一个被称为sql buffer的内存区域中,并且只能保存一条最近执行的sql语句,我们可以对保存在sql buffer中的sql 语句进行修改,然后再次执行,sqlplus一般都与数据库打交道。 常用:sqlplus username/password 如:普通用户登录 sqlplus sco
回车之后会发生什么? shell解释你的命令行 shell执行一些替换 shell在内存中装载你的命令 shell建立I/O的重定向 shell执行你的命令程序 shell等待你程序执行结束 shell等待下一条命令 当用户输入命令按回车之后,shell在执行命令之前会先解释该命令。当shell执行脚本
转载
2024-06-09 00:01:13
42阅读
在数据库调优过程中,SQL语句往往是导致性能问题的主要原因,而执行计划则是解释SQL语句执行过程的语言,只有充分读懂执行计划才能在数据库性能优化中做到游刃有余。 常见的关系型数据库中,虽然执行计划的表示方法各自不同,但执行原理却大同小异。在我看来,SQL语句的执行过程中总共包含两个关键环节:读取数据的方式(scan):包含表扫描和索引扫描表之间如何进行连接(join):包含Nest Lo
转载
2024-05-03 13:00:09
539阅读
由 Paul Yip 维护
IBM 多伦多实验室
2002 年 12 月
这篇文章的读者是那些参与项目的人员,他们用 DB2 Everyplace 进行计划、设置和执行一个机动项目。计划要描述用 DB2 Everyplace 的机动项目的生命周期,进而减少开发强度和降低项目成本。我们的提示和建议都以参与用 DB2 Everyplace 版本 7
Linux Shell脚本ldd命令原理及使用方法 1、首先ldd不是一个可执行程序,而只是一个shell脚本 2、ldd能够显示可执行模块的dependency,其原理是通过设置一系列的环境变量,如下:LD_TRACE_LOADED_OBJECTS、LD_WARN、LD_BIND_NOW、LD_LIBRARY_VERSION、LD_VERBOSE等。当LD_TRACE_LOADED_OBJECT
1. for语句1.1 for…do…done(固定循环)for 这种语法,则是“已经知道要进行几次循环”的状态!for的语法for 的语法是:
for var in con1 con2 con3 ...
do
程序段
done
以上面的例子来说,这个 $var 的变量内容在循环工作时:
1. 第一次循环时, $var 的内容为 con1;
2. 第二次循环时, $var 的内容为 con
转载
2024-10-25 08:33:26
43阅读
Shell脚本调试选项Shell本身提供一些调试方法选项:-n,读一遍脚本中的命令但不执行,用于检查脚本中的语法错误。-v,一边执行脚本,一边将执行过的脚本命令打印到标准输出。-x,提供跟踪执行信息,将执行的每一条命令和结果依次打印出来。使用这些选项有三种方法1.在命令行提供参数:$sh -x script.sh2.脚本开头提供参数:#!/bin/sh -x3.在脚本中用set命令启用or禁用参数
转载
2024-07-23 10:10:39
104阅读
开发工具:Web Sphere Development1、DB2 支持多种语言编程。如COBOL、C、C++等,这些语言称为宿主语言,SQL语句要以嵌入的方式与宿主语言结合在一起,宿主语言通过宿主变量来操作数据库。这样SQL语句以EXEC SQL开始。2、使用嵌入式SQL的程序首先要通过DB2的预编译器进行预编译,把嵌入的SQL语句翻译成宿主语言的代码和函数,然后经过宿主语言编译器的编译把DB2的
转载
2024-05-24 19:33:57
530阅读
很久没有些博客了.把以前用到的操作 DB2 的命令发表下可能有很多人已经发布了.就当是自己做下功课吧,以备有用之需.1、 打开命令行窗口 #db2cmd 2、 打开控制中心 # db2cmd db2cc 3、 打开命令编辑器 db2cmd db2ce =====操作数据库命令===== 4、 启动数据库实例 #db2start 5、 停止数据库实例 #db2stop 如果你不能停
转载
2024-07-30 17:23:02
36阅读
1.FTP的简单使用说明1)FTP是文件传输协议(File Transfer Protocal)的简写,主要完成与远程计算机的文件传输。2)FTP使用格式ftp [-v] [-d] [-i] [-n] [-g] [-s:filename] [-a] [-w:windowsize] [computer]·&nb
转载
2024-03-18 17:23:58
31阅读
MongoDB自带了一个javascript shell,可以从命令行与MongoDB交互运行运行mongo 启动shell我在运行的时候出现了这样的错误:不能连接到服务 :\mongodb\mongodb-win32-i386-2.4.4\bin>mongo
ongoDB shell version: 2.4.4
onnecting to: test
at Jun 08 09:01:36
转载
2024-06-28 14:15:09
41阅读
第一个问题:远程创建Database 近段时间项目的原因,需要通过远程方式在DB2 server上创建DB,执行创建表格插入数据等操作,创建表格和插入数据等功能可以通过ant提供的SQL完成,而创建DB却不行,于是采用了DB2 client这个工具,它的理念是通过在本地创建一个node,连接到远程DB2 server上,然后就可以本地进行
转载
2024-04-24 09:11:54
165阅读
1. BDB XML之运行Shell1.1 下载BDB XML 二进制文件首先打开官网的下载页面 Oracle Berkeley DB Downloads
下载适合自己电脑的安装包我的电脑是64为就下载按照我的电脑是64为就下载x64注意:*.msi 是二进制编译好的文件, .zip 和.tar.gz 是windows 和linux 压缩的未编译的源码文件,我们要下载二进制编译好的文件默认安装路径
转载
2024-04-15 22:54:08
280阅读
1、runstatsrunsats可以搜集表的信息,也可以搜集索引信息。作为runstats本身没有优化的功能,但是它更新了统计信息以后,可以让DB2优化器使用最新的统计信息来进行优化,这样优化的效果更好。 runstats on table <tbschema>.<t
DB2查询优化和执行计划是数据库性能调优的重要方面。下面将结合代码详解DB2查询优化和执行计划的相关知识点。查询优化在DB2中,查询优化是通过选择最优的执行计划来实现的。执行计划是指DB2引擎从多种可能的访问路径中选择一条最优的路径来执行查询。优化查询的主要目标是选择优化器来执行查询并生成最小的执行计划。优化器是一个DB2子系统组件,它负责选择最优的执行计划。1.1 查询优化器查询优化器是负责选择
Linux系统下DB2Linux系统下启动DB2常用的一些数据库指令1.数据库相关操作2.表的相关操作 Linux系统下启动DB21.修改主机名为db2vi /etc/sysconfig/network将文件内容修改为:NETWORKING=yes
HOSTNAME=db22.修改/etc/hosts 中主机名为db2 将文件修改成为如下:127.0.0.1 redhat6 localhost
转载
2024-03-01 07:16:45
147阅读
DB2数据库的备份与恢复技术的详细解说,我觉得这篇文章实用性很强,对操作步骤进行了详细的说明,按照文章的指引可以成功的实现DB2的备份和恢复工作。希望对大家有所帮助。 数据库恢复操作使用数据库备份映象来重新创建数据库。如果要将数据库从一台机器克隆到另一台,最简单的方法就是从备份映象恢复
转载
2024-06-06 20:12:29
213阅读
最近写一个DB2的REORG的脚本,因为以前在mysql里面是没有接触过这个REORG的,所以系统了解一下,我的学习的话是先从命令入手,看看这个名的结构,然后还有选项,这些选项会揭示一些这个命令能干什么事,了解了命令,命令的选项之后再去看相关的理论,再结合理解一下应该就会比较清晰一些了。 所以先来看命令吧。REORG INDEXES/TABLE Command重新组织一个索引或一张表。你可以通过
转载
2024-02-24 06:01:14
635阅读
名词解释:reorg 重组,重新放置数据位置。runstats 统计信息,可以优化查询器注意:执行完reorg,再执行runstats,顺序不能乱例如:db2下执行下面脚本call admin_cmd('reorg table 模式.表名');
call admin_cmd('runstats on table 模式.表名 with distribution and detailed index
转载
2024-02-26 12:40:02
201阅读
1.创建事件监控器至少需要哪些权限? DBADM authority SQLADM authority 2.事件监控器的种类有哪些? 3. db2 flush event monitor eventmonitorname命令的用途是什么 将当前的数据库监控数据写入到对应的文件中 4.打开或关闭监视器的命令是否是db2 set event monitor eventmon
转载
2024-05-06 17:20:25
45阅读